Changing
Colors
.
seN
-"
You
can shoot images with the original colors transformed. This can
be performed on movies as well as still images, allowing you to
enjoy photographing with image or movie effects.
However, depending on the shooting conditions, the images may
appear rough or you may not get the expected color. Before you try
to photograph important subjects,
we
highly recommend that you
shoot trial images and check the results.
If you set [Save Original]
(p.
66) to [On] when shooting a still image,
you can record the original image as well the transformed one.
~
Color Accent
II
Color Swap
Use this option to have only the color specified
in
the
LCD monitor remain and to transform all others to
black and white.
Use this option to transform a color specified in the
LCD monitor into another. The specified color can
only be swapped into one other color, multiple colors
cannot be chosen.
